Case Summary: In SLP(C) No. 18026/2000, Rakesh Kumar challenged a Delhi High Court order dated 12/10/2000 that had fixed a certain amount. During the hearing on 17/11/2000 before Justices S. Rajendra Babu and B.N. Agrawal, the petitioner's counsel sought permission to withdraw the petition to pursue reduction of the amount in the High Court instead. The Supreme Court dismissed the special leave petition as withdrawn. This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
